No checks on loophole

- BY BEN GLAZE Deputy Political Editor

THE Government has admitted in written parliament­ary questions that it does not look at how much tax oil and gas giants are avoiding via a loophole in its windfall levy.

Lib Dem Sarah Olney said it was “incompeten­t they won’t even check how much more is set to be lost” under the “botched” tax. The Treasury said the Energy Profits Levy is “expected to raise £17billion this year”.
